The Executive Chairman of Ibadan North East Local Government, Hon. Ibrahim Akintayo (aka “O mu Yes”), extends warm felicitations to the Muslim community in Ibadan North East Local Government and its environs on the successful conclusion of Ramadan fasting.

In a release signed by the Council’s Information Officer, Ikeoye Oyetoro, Chairman Akintayo praises the devotion, resilience, and spiritual growth demonstrated by Muslims during the Ramadan period. He acknowledges the significance of Ramadan in fostering unity, compassion, and generosity among people and urges everyone to continue embracing the values of love, kindness, and forgiveness that this holy month embodies.

Hon Akintayo also felicitates with Muslim brothers and sisters in Ibadan North East Local Government and its environs, as well as religious leaders, the League of Imams, political leaders, traditional council, Legislative Council, supervisors, Special Assistants, management staff, and the entire staff members of the local government.

The Council Boss also wishes the Executive Governor of Oyo State, Engr Seyi Makinde a joyous Eid-el-Fitri celebration while commending his relentless efforts towards the betterment of Oyo State, praising his leadership and vision, which have been a beacon of hope for the people of Oyo State.

Chairman Akintayo further encourages the Muslim community to extend the lessons learned during Ramadan to their daily lives, promoting a culture of peace, tolerance, and understanding.

He also urges the community to continue their good deeds and acts of charity, which have been a hallmark of the holy month. By doing so, our community can build a more harmonious and prosperous society, where everyone can live in peace and happiness.

Once again, Hon Akintayo wishes the Muslim community a happy Eid-el-Fitri celebration, and prays that the blessings of Allah be upon them all.
